Hope it works out well and it likely will. My only experience with a conversion was on a heavy plane for a conversion at around 12.3 pounds, a Phaeton 90. It flew scale like and was a delight on take offs and landings. The engine was 100 percent reliable, can't recall it ever hiccup except at the end when the ignition unit failed and it wouldn't start, but it gracefully did that in its sleep so posed no threat to the plane. It would pull a loop if some speed was gained going down hill and the loop not too big. It was a pleasure to fly although the aerobatic potentials only came alive after replacing with a Zenoah G-20 after the ignition failed.
